  22. #ifndef _PPC_BOOK3S_64_HW_BREAKPOINT_H
  23. #define _PPC_BOOK3S_64_HW_BREAKPOINT_H
  24. #ifdef __KERNEL__
  25. #ifdef CONFIG_HAVE_HW_BREAKPOINT
  26. struct arch_hw_breakpoint {
  27. bool extraneous_interrupt;
  28. u8 len; /* length of the target data symbol */
  29. int type;
  30. unsigned long address;
  31. };
  32. #include <linux/kdebug.h>
  33. #include <asm/reg.h>
  34. #include <asm/system.h>
  35. struct perf_event;
  36. struct pmu;
  37. struct perf_sample_data;
  38. #define HW_BREAKPOINT_ALIGN 0x7
  39. /* Maximum permissible length of any HW Breakpoint */
  40. #define HW_BREAKPOINT_LEN 0x8
  41. extern int hw_breakpoint_slots(int type);
  42. extern int arch_bp_generic_fields(int type, int *gen_bp_type);
  43. extern int arch_check_bp_in_kernelspace(struct perf_event *bp);
  44. extern int arch_validate_hwbkpt_settings(struct perf_event *bp);
  45. extern int hw_breakpoint_exceptions_notify(struct notifier_block *unused,
  46. unsigned long val, void *data);
  47. int arch_install_hw_breakpoint(struct perf_event *bp);
  48. void arch_uninstall_hw_breakpoint(struct perf_event *bp);
  49. void hw_breakpoint_pmu_read(struct perf_event *bp);
  50. extern void flush_ptrace_hw_breakpoint(struct task_struct *tsk);
  51. extern struct pmu perf_ops_bp;
  52. extern void ptrace_triggered(struct perf_event *bp, int nmi,
  53. struct perf_sample_data *data, struct pt_regs *regs);
  54. static inline void hw_breakpoint_disable(void)
  55. {
  56. set_dabr(0);
  57. }
  58. extern void thread_change_pc(struct task_struct *tsk, struct pt_regs *regs);
  59. #else /* CONFIG_HAVE_HW_BREAKPOINT */
  60. static inline void hw_breakpoint_disable(void) { }
  61. static inline void thread_change_pc(struct task_struct *tsk,
  62. struct pt_regs *regs) { }
  63. #endif /* CONFIG_HAVE_HW_BREAKPOINT */
  64. #endif /* __KERNEL__ */
  65. #endif /* _PPC_BOOK3S_64_HW_BREAKPOINT_H */
